#13c595 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#13c595 is composed of 7.5% red, 77.3%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 24.4%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 163.8 degrees, a saturation of 82.4% and a lightness of 42.4%. #13c595 color hex could be obtained by blending #26ffff with #008b2b. Closest websafe color is: #00cc99.

Shades and Tints of #13c595

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#edfd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#13c595

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#66726f is the less saturated color, while #02d69d is the most saturated one.
